Self Reflection in 6 steps🪞
One effective method I've discovered for improving my mentality is self-reflection. Self-reflection is an ongoing process where you stimulate personal growth by reviewing aspects of your day, your week, or your overall life.🗓️
Self-Re·flec·tion: meditation or serious thought about one's character, actions, and motives.

In the midst of our busy lives, finding time for self-reflection is vital for learning and growth. It enables us to build upon successes, breaking free from self-doubt and embracing our true purpose for a fulfilling life. ⛓️💥
It's crucial to clarify that self-reflection doesn't entail dwelling on negative past experiences. Revisiting the past unproductively or fixating on the future is equally detrimental. 🆘
While we can't alter the past, we can use self-compassion to reflect and learn in the present. ✍️
The 6 steps 👣 👣 👣 👣 👣 👣
1. Dedicate time for self-reflection, choosing a quiet space to be alone with your thoughts.
2. Listen to your inner voice by writing down thoughts or engaging in activities like walking or meditation.
3. Allow your thoughts to flow without attempting to control them, tuning in to the messages they convey.
4. Trust the guidance provided by reflection, even if it doesn't offer concrete evidence for your choices.
5. Reflect consistently, even during positive phases, to release hidden stresses and discover keys to personal growth.
6. Read Step 5 Again.
With practice, your confidence will grow, and you'll appreciate the quiet moments of reflection as valuable opportunities for personal development. By looking back, we can gain insights into our lives, ultimately paving the way for a more purposeful future. Self-reflection is a potent and liberating experience that smoothens life's challenges, enhances happiness, and facilitates the manifestation of becoming who we are meant to be. ⬆️🏅💼🏆📈
